This food chain may be adjusted by stocking of water with certain fish species along with P lots decreases, in initiatives to lower the incidence of algal flowers as well as improve general water top quality. For example, equipping lakes with aggressive game fish at the top of the food chain can minimize the number of planktivore or coarser fish, on which they feed. Zooplankton should then thrive, which consequently will certainly minimize phytoplankton populations, enhancing water high quality. As an example, several researches have actually indicated little reduction in lake performance with lowered P inputs complying with application of preservation procedures (Gray and also Kirkland, 1986; Youthful as well as DePinto, 1982). The lack of organic feedback was credited to an enhanced bioavailability of P getting in the lakes as well as inner recycling. Clearly, reliable restorative methods must deal with the administration of P resources as well as applications as well as disintegration and also overflow control. While the majority of fresh waters are P minimal, there are noteworthy exemptions where P controls will certainly have marginal to no advantage. In some lakes and also in many streams, plant efficiency is limited by high turbidity either from anthropogenic or natural sources. In others, such as the high-elevation lakes in the western USA, N is restricting.

One of the very first considerations is the quantity needed to introduce and maintain a commercial item. If one coats 1μg of capture antibody per strip and also wants to make 1 million strips, the amount of antibody needed to do so would certainly be a minimum of 1g. For that reason, making sure that distributors can produce large volumes with consistent top quality is extremely important.
